WebJun 28, 2024 · Consider these factors to create a daycare play area that all children will enjoy. 1. Consider Capacity. Consider how many children will be using your playground at one time to determine how large your playground should be. Make sure your daycare playground layout provides adequate space for free and safe play. WebIn fact, preschool should not be a sit-and-listen year, at any time of the day. Mark a large square on the ground or pavement divided into four, five-foot squares. Number the squares clockwise from 1 to 4. Play begins when the player in square 4 hits a rubber playground ball to the player in the next square (#1), who must hit the ball to the next square (#2) after only one bounce. dari motion incWebAt the middle school level I have the behaviors written on a drawn stairway. 1.
